CHECKLIST ITEM 7 — OFF-SITE RUN, RECEIVING SITE
Shipment: stage props for the Moonglass Revue tour, four flight cases from Thistledown Stageworks. On arrival: check seals intact, photograph each case before moving, log weights against the advance sheet. Cases 2 and 4 contain glass set pieces — keep upright, no forklift tines under the short edge. Store in the climate bay, not the open yard. The inbound courier from Bramley Haulage expects the hand-over instruction stated below.

courier memo of yawep-yafog: the pramir ulaix courier leaves the ulavan aldix frair zorok oliiel joreth rusdor fenvan ledger at gate 1305 under passcode 514738

Handover note — Crumbwheel order cutoffs.

Welcome aboard. The bakery cutoff rule in Crumbwheel closes same-day orders at 14:00 local to each storefront, not UTC — this has bitten us twice. Holiday overrides live in the calendar service and take precedence silently, so always check there first when a cutoff looks wrong. To unlock the calendar service's admin console after a restart, enter the recovery passphrase below.

vault phrase of bagap-bahaf = silion-pelox-sorox-casdor-quenwyn-fraax-eliox-praael-kelion-quenvan-kasox-rusael-norius-belvan

Subject: Handover — VramScope profiling DB

Taking over VramScope admin duties from me as of Friday. Plugin authors hit the profiling store read-only; allocation snapshots land every 10 minutes via the ingest worker. Don't touch retention jobs — they're owned by the Kestrel team. Schema docs live in the plugin SDK repo under /docs/profiling. If a plugin needs historical GPU memory traces, it queries the replica, never primary. Access for external plugin development goes through the sandbox instance, reachable with the connection string below.

replica DSN, kajep-yahag: mssql://praok_svc:iF@db-8d68.plorvaio.local:5432/eliion